Output 828f2658eaa6752700c25b1affd37a1e805590d73f98326bbde15f21d6d5a373:2

value
8665600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9322c41f22e2b7d0c85ddb6b4d79d011f3227d8c OP_EQUAL
address
3F6zuLKBkBZsbfPNsyaDaKxfToqDMpTEQf
transaction
828f2658eaa6752700c25b1affd37a1e805590d73f98326bbde15f21d6d5a373
spent
true